Airas - Jilasu, Chamoli
Airas is a village situated in the Jilasu tehsil of Chamoli district, Uttarakhand. It is located approximately 42 km from Pokhari and around 35 km from Gopeshwar. Airas village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Airas is 041264. The village covers a total geographical area of 132.83 hectares and falls under the 246446 pincode. Karnaprayag is the nearest town, located about 11 km away.
Airas village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Gram Pradhan ser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Badrinath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Garhwal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Airas
According to the 2011 Census, Airas village had a total population of 330 people, including 161 males and 169 females, living in 75 households. The sex ratio was 1,050 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 78.38%, with male literacy at 87.32% and female literacy at 70.13%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 134.

Transport and Connectivity of Airas
Airas is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ared van services. The nearest railway station is Kotdwara, while the nearest airport is Dehradun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 89.1 km.
